Ikenna Azuike started his career as a lawyer, but is now a sought-after journalist, presenter, speaker and filmmaker. Ikenna was born in Lagos, Nigeria, grew up in the UK, studied law in the UK and France and has been living in The Netherlands with his family since 2004.

Since 2017 Ikenna has worked on a variety of longer form journalistic projects through his own production company Jollof Rice Productions B.V. For example, he produced the 6-part travel docudrama ‘De Afro-Europeaan’ (The Afro-European) for VPRO. As part of this workshop, certain scenes of this production will be screened, followed by a conversation with Ikenna.
